Benefits of New Double Glazing
As property owners pursue energy performance and comfort, the popularity of double glazing has actually surged recently. This window innovation includes utilizing two panes of glass separated by an air or gas-filled area, which significantly improves insulation compared to single-pane windows. The advantages of new double glazing extend beyond energy cost savings, influencing comfort, noise decrease, and residential or commercial property worth. 2. Energy Efficiency
One of the main benefits of brand-new double glazing is its contribution to energy efficiency.
2.1 Reduced Energy Bills
The insulating properties of double glazing significantly lower the amount of heat loss in winter and gain in summer season, which equates to considerable cost savings on cooling and heating costs. According to research study, homes with double-glazed windows can save up to 20% on their energy expenses.
To show, here's a contrast of energy expenses before and after the installation of double glazing:
| Type of Window | Typical Monthly Energy Bill |
|---|---|
| Single Pane | ₤ 200 |
| Double Glazed | ₤ 160 |
2.2 Enhanced Thermal Comfort
Double glazing creates an efficiently insulated barrier, maintaining a more stable indoor temperature. Unlike single-glazed windows, which enable drafts and temperature fluctuations, double-glazed windows assist to produce a constant environment, devoid of cold spots and improving general convenience.
3. Sound Reduction
For homeowners living in bustling urban areas or near busy roads, sound pollution can detract considerably from their quality of life.
- How Double Glazing Helps:
- The air or gas between the glass panes absorbs sound waves, making double-glazed windows exceptional at noise reduction.
- Studies reveal that double-glazed windows can reduce external noise by as much as 80%.
This function adds considerable value to homes in noise-prone locations, as quieter indoor environments are significantly searched for.
4. Condensation Prevention
Condensation typically forms on single-pane windows, causing moisture and mold problems.
- Benefits of Double Glazing in This Respect:
- The inner pane of a double-glazed window stays warmer than that of a single-pane window, decreasing the conditions that cultivate condensation.
- This adds to a much healthier indoor environment, minimizing moisture-related problems.

8. Frequently asked questions
Q1: How long do double-glazed windows last?
A1: Double-glazed windows can last more than 20 years if maintained effectively.
Q2: Is double glazing worth the investment?
A2: Yes, the long-lasting energy cost savings, increased home worth, and enhanced convenience make double glazing a rewarding investment.
Q3: Can I change just some windows with double glazing?
A3: Yes, house owners can replace specific windows with double-glazed models while keeping older windows. Nevertheless, think about the aesthetic consistency of the home.
Q4: What maintenance do double-glazed windows require?
A4: Regular cleansing and look for seals are advised to guarantee optimal efficiency.
Q5: Can I install double glazing myself?
A5: While some might select to install double glazing individually, employing professional installers is advised to guarantee effective sealing and performance.
